Phish will return for their fourteenth New Years Run at the storied Madison Square Garden on December 29, 2021 through January 1st, 2022. This is the first time that the band has played at the venue since the December 31st, 2019 New Years show that left guitarist Trey Anastasio stuck in the rafters on a dangling platform after a mechanical failure during their annual New Years gag.

The Rolling Stones today release the previously unheard track “Troubles A’ Comin” via Polydor/Interscope/UMe. The never-before-released song is set to feature on the upcoming, newly remastered 40th anniversary editions of chart-topping, multi-platinum 1981 album Tattoo You. “Troubles A’ Comin” is out today, September 30, listen here and watch the lyric video here.

Founding members of The New Mastersounds & The Greyboy Allstars have formed The Rare Sounds featuring Eddie Roberts (The New Mastersounds), Robert Walter (The Greyboy Allstars), Chris Stillwell (The Greyboy Allstars), and Zak Najor (Karl Denson's Tiny Universe, formerly GBA). The group has released their debut single "Yeah, You" ahead of their debut performances at Cervantes' Masterpiece Ballroom in Denver, CO on October 1st & 2nd.

Celebrated archival reissue label Light in the Attic (LITA) is proud to announce the release of Another Side, a previously-unreleased, early ‘70s studio album by Leo Nocentelli of the pioneering New Orleans funk outfit, The Meters.
